Executive Summary
In 2025, runtime defenses alone are too late. By the time a misconfiguration or vulnerability is detected in production, attackers may already have exploited it. Enter Shift-Left Security: embedding security checks directly into the CI/CD pipeline, ensuring every commit, build, and infrastructure change is validated before reaching production.
Shift-left is not just about scanning for CVEs—it’s about enforcing guardrails early:
-
Deny a Terraform plan that attempts to create a public S3 bucket.
-
Block Kubernetes manifests that allow privileged containers.
-
Fail a CI job if secrets are committed to Git.
-
Break the pipeline if an API route lacks authentication or schema validation.
With policy-as-code, automated tests, and deny-by-default, Shift-Left becomes the only realistic way to secure high-velocity engineering environments.
Why Shift-Left Security Matters
-
Speed of Change
-
Modern orgs deploy hundreds of changes per day. Manual security review is impossible.
-
-
Cost of Fixing Late
-
Fixing misconfig in design = minutes.
-
Fixing in runtime = downtime, breaches, lawsuits.
-
-
Attackers Exploit Config Errors
-
Public S3 buckets, open IAM roles, weak Kubernetes RBAC, unvalidated APIs—these are real-world breach vectors.
-
-
CI/CD as a Control Point
-
Every change flows through pipelines. Enforcing security as part of build/test ensures consistency and scale.
-
Core Principles of Shift-Left Security
-
Security as Code
-
Policies live in Git, reviewed and tested like app code.
-
No PDFs, no “tribal knowledge.”
-
-
Fail Fast, Fail Loud
-
Violations block the pipeline, not silently logged.
-
Developers learn instantly, reducing feedback loop.
-
-
Deny by Default
-
Any unknown or insecure configuration is blocked.
-
Teams explicitly justify exceptions with policy overrides.
-
-
Automated Everywhere
-
From IaC scans to container linting to dependency checks—everything runs automatically, every commit.
-

Building a Shift-Left Pipeline
Phase 1: Integrate Security Scanners
-
IaC: tfsec, Checkov, OPA/Sentinel.
-
Containers: Trivy, Grype.
-
Code: Semgrep, Bandit.
-
Secrets: Gitleaks, detect-secrets.
Phase 2: Enforce Policy-as-Code
-
Store policies in Git.
-
Run policy unit tests in CI.
-
Deny merges if policies fail.
Phase 3: Continuous Testing
-
Regression suites for known misconfigs.
-
Negative tests proving denials work.
-
Integration tests simulating real deployments.
Phase 4: Feedback & Culture
-
Developers own security fixes.
-
Security team builds guardrails, not bottlenecks.
-
Exceptions are time-boxed and audited.
KPIs for Shift-Left Security
-
Policy Coverage: % of repos/pipelines enforcing security checks.
-
Violation MTTR: Time to fix blocked misconfigs.
-
False Negative Rate: % of misconfigs reaching runtime.
-
Pipeline Block Rate: How many insecure changes blocked at CI vs prod.
-
Developer Adoption: % of teams writing policy tests alongside app tests.
